#0
by mzelensky
Читаю СП, но чет один момент не догоняю. Имеется форма, на ней (по порядку сверху вниз): табличное поле(ВнешнийОтбор), разделитель (Разделитель1) и табличный документ (Результат). Хочу чтобы по нажатии на кнопку табличное поле схлопывалось и табличный документ растягивался на всю форму. Делаю: Элементыформы.ДействияФормы.Кнопки.Действие6.пометка=не Элементыформы.ДействияФормы.Кнопки.Действие6.пометка; Так у меня по кнопке сворачивается и разворачивается табличное поле (внешний отбор) и разделитель (Разделитель1). Как теперь установить привязки, чтобы табличный документ растянулся вверх ???
#1
by mzelensky
Согласно СП: Расширение элементов управления, расположенных на панели УстановитьПривязку (SetLink) Синтаксис: УстановитьПривязку(<Граница>, <Первый элемент>, <Граница первого элемента>, <Второй элемент>, <Граница второго элемента>) Параметры: <Граница> (обязательный) Тип: ГраницаЭлементаУправления. Граница элемента управления, для которой устанавливается привязка. <Первый элемент> (необязательный) Элемент управления, к которому будет жестко привязана указанная граница. <Граница первого элемента> (необязательный) Тип: ГраницаЭлементаУправления. Граница первого элемента управления, к которой будет жестко привязана указанная граница. <Второй элемент> (необязательный) Элемент управления, для пропорциональной привязки к нему указанной границы. <Граница второго элемента> (необязательный) Тип: ГраницаЭлементаУправления. Граница второго элемента, к которой будет пропорционально привязана указанная граница. нужно указать : вторым параметром ЭЛЕМЕНТ ФОРМЫ, к которому нужно привязаться....но мне то, по идее, нужно привязаться к ФОРМЕ...а она этого не дает... :( подскажите КАК?
#4
by mzelensky
Причем привязаться к разделителю обратно получается: а вот растянуть табличный док на всю форму не выходит:
#6
by Bolik1979
Ошибся - "Панель" просто Использование: Только чтение. Описание: Тип: Панель. Содержит главную панель формы. Доступность: Толстый клиент.
#10
by Axel2009
привязки нужно устанавливать у 2х элементов.. разделитель верхнюю границу нужно привязывать к верхней границе формы тоже..
#11
by mzelensky
Короче я не знаю почему, но работает вот так: В общем...по принципу - если работает, то лучше не трогать :)
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Помогите пожалйста установить компоненту 1С++
- Использую построитель отчета. Как установить ширину колонок отчета?
- установить рабочую дату программно
- Как программно установить событие для элемента управления "поле ввода"?
- Как программно установить владельца программно созданной колонке
- Установить привязки программно
- Табличную часть растянуть по всей панели. Программно через установить привязки.
- Программно установить привязки
- Установить время документа
В этой группе 1С
- Как посмотреть регламентных заданий пользователя,
- Учет основных средств на забалансовом счете
- v7: Испортили нумерацию документов.. как исправить?
- Снимаются с проведения документы при обмене УТ-РТ
- v8: Ошибка при подключении к базе Firebird через внешние источники
- Конвертация данных Единицы измерения УТ 11 -> УТ 10.3
- Как программно добавить картинку в УТ 11 (управляемое приложение)
- УТ 11 и подбор в Заказ покупателя
- Одноуровневая иерархия
- Ошибка при формировании внешней печатной формы
- v8: 1с-логистика: управление перевозками + упп
- 8.2 БГУ СКД Пользовательский отбор
- Как сделать, чтобы окно 1С предприятия открывалось на втором мониторе
- Типовая загрузка-выгрузка сообщения РИБ
- Скрипт под windows на vbs и т.д. для запуска РИБ
- Загрузка номенклатуры из иерархического Excel
- Раскраска табличного поля по строкам
- УТ11: Создание печатной формы приходной накладной с розн.ценами
- Как программно вызвать команду справочника?
- Отражение операций по продаже валюты в 1С БП 8.2.?